What does “mad cuz bad” mean?
It’s a playful insult used online, especially in gaming, suggesting someone is upset because they’re not good at something.
Is “mad cuz bad” meant to be toxic?
Usually it’s just light teasing, but tone matters. In competitive environments it can feel toxic if used aggressively.
